Appeal for urgent resurfacing of Eglinton’s Woodvale Road

written by cassoscoop May 6, 2023
ShareTweet

People Before Profit’s Faughan representative Damian Gallagher

People Before Profit’s Faughan representative has called on the Department of Infrastructure to urgently carry out resurfacing of Woodvale Road in Eglinton.

Said Mr Gallagher: “The issue of unsuitable large HGV lorries using the village of Eglinton as a short cut and the negative impact that this is having upon local homes, people and the environment is well noted.

“However, there is an urgent need to address the dangerously poor state of the Woodvale Road surface itself.

“The road markings warning for ‘school’ at Dunverne Gardens and close to the two bus stops is nearly now
unreadable due to traffic erosion.

“The road is clearly showing signs of rapid disintegration in many parts and I would appeal to all pedestrians and residents to exercise caution in the area and to ask drivers to please slow down.

“I have written to DFI asking them to address this as a matter of urgency and ensure the safety of schoolchildren, road users and pedestrians using the area.”
